Lake Shore Central Appoints Board of Education Officers

Michalec and Thompson return as President and Vice President

The Lake Shore Central School District Board of Education is pleased to announce that residing President Jennifer Michalec and Vice President Carla Thompson will continue to serve in these positions for the 2017-18 school year. Michalec begins her twelfth year as a member of the Board and sixth as President, while recently re-elected Thompson starts her tenth year of service and eighth as Vice President.

“Lake Shore has been fortunate to have these very dedicated Board members serving our schools and community for nearly a decade,” said Lake Shore Superintendent James Przepasniak. “Mrs. Michalec and Mrs. Thompson are highly knowledgeable and committed to providing our students with the best education, learning opportunities, and facilities in Western New York.”

Michalec has completed numerous hours of board development opportunities such as, fiscal oversight training, law conferences, and various other workshops. She has completed the requirements of the NYSSBA’s School Board Institute and is actively involved in the Erie County Association of School Board Association. She has served on Lake Shore’s Policy Review Committee, Code of Conduct Review Committee, Budget Committee, and the Administrative Leadership Committee. She currently sits on our Audit Committee, Athletics Committee, Board Recognition Program Committee, and Safety Committee.

Thompson taught English in the Lake Shore District for 35 years and has attended workshops on School Board Governance, Fiscal Responsibility, School Law, Common Core, Module Teaching, and APPR. She has been recognized for her exemplary participation in the New York State School Board Association’s School Board Institute and has participated in the Lake Shore Redistricting Committee, Budget Subcommittee, Administrative Interview Committee, and Capital Construction Project Steering Committee, and has been an alternate delegate to the Erie County School Board Association Finance committee.

Both Michalec and Thompson are residents of the community with children who have graduated from or are currently attending Lake Shore schools.

Some benefits of growing older....

Many people are quick to think of growing older in a negative light. Although there certainly are some side effects of aging that one may wish to avoid, people may find that the benefits of growing older outweigh the negatives.

Seniors are a rapidly growing segment of the population. In the United States, the Administration on Aging states that the older population — persons 65 years or older — numbered 46.2 million in 2014 (the latest year for which data is available). Statistics Canada reports that, in July 2015, estimates indicated that there were more persons aged 65 years and older in Canada than children aged 0 to 14 years for the first time in the country’s history. Nearly one in six Canadians (16.1%) was at least 65 years old. With so many people living longer, it’s time to celebrate the perks of getting older rather than the drawbacks. Here are some great benefits to growing old.

• Higher self-esteem: The insecurities of youth give way as one ages, and older people have less negativity and higher self-esteem. A University of Basel study of people ranging in ages from 18 to 89 found that regardless of demographic and social status, the older one gets the higher self-esteem climbs. Qualities like self-control and altruism can contribute to happiness.

• Financial perks: Seniors are entitled to discounts on meals, museum entry fees, movies, and other entertainment if they’re willing to disclose their ages. Discounts are available through an array of venues if one speaks up. Seniors also can enjoy travel perks, with slashed prices on resorts, plane tickets and more. The U.S. National Park Service offers citizens age 62 and older lifetime passes to more than 2,000 federal recreation sites for just $10 in person ($20 online or via mail).

• Reasoning and problem-solving skills: Brain scans reveal that older adults are more likely to use both hemispheres of their brans simultaneously — something called bilateralization. This can sharpen reasoning skills. For example, in a University of Illinois study, older air traffic controllers excelled at their cognitively taxing jobs, despite some losses in short-term memory and visual spatial processing. Older controllers proved to be experts at navigating, juggling multiple aircrafts simultaneously and avoiding collisions.

• Less stress: As people grow older, they are able to differentiate their needs from wants and focus on more important goals. This can alleviate worry over things that are beyond one’s control. Seniors may realize how little the opinions of others truly mean in the larger picture, thereby feeling less stress about what others think of them.

Hamburg Kingsmen Perform at Brant Summer Fest

The Hamburg Kingsmen Alumni Marching Band performed at the 14th Annual Brant Summer Festival on Sunday June 11, 2017. This is the third year the band has attended the summer festival and the group’s outstanding music was enjoyed by all in attendance. In the photo above, the band is shown preparing their lineup for the parade. Following the parade, they gave two superb mini concerts. Over 50 band members were in attendance and participated! The Kingsmen’s performance was made possible by Chiavetta’s Catering, Councilman Mark & Michelle DeCarlo, Bill & Patty Friend, Judge Clark and Donna Borngraber, Beverly Wasmund and Janet Bowman.

Paint the Village of Angola Beautiful Project

On July 22, 2017 the Village of Angola hosted a one day, community service effort to “beautify” nine buildings in it’s business district. Approximately 108 members from our community and beyond volunteered their time to paint facades, paint tables and chairs, shingle an overhang, clean inside and outside of buildings, plant flowers, pull weeds, mow lawns, sweep sidewalks, trim shrubs, wash windows, put up shutters, flower boxes and signage, play music, feed volunteers, and add white lights to our tree lined Main Street in the Village of Angola. The idea was started by two friends who regularly took walks that led them through Main Street. They went door to door to recruit workers and also took up collections from residents and area businesses to help pay for the supplies to help their neighbors in the business district “beautify” their buildings. Our major donors were Gernatt Asphalt Products, Goya Foods, and Dr. Mark Damerau. New Era Cap, Shultz & Co Hardware and Appliances, Ace Hardware, Chiavetta’s Greenhouse. Home Depot, Tim Clark, Evans Garden Club, Addison’s Funeral Home, Connors Hotdog Stand, Lake Shore Hardware, Sam’s Lumber, Tops Angola location Basil’s Service Center, the Angola Pennysaver Inc., and local residents were also instrumental in helping the funding of this project.

As the saying goes, “Many Hands Make Light Work”, and this grass roots effort was a success due to the outpouring and enthusiasm of the volunteers that showed up to make a difference in their community. Thank you for your generosity in time, talent, and financial resources. It truly was an inspirational day. Without all of you, the transformations that took place on one day would not have been possible.

This is just the first step to bring new life to our rural community. Angola is rich with history in trains, and bicycles, and can claim inventors that have impacted the world. We will be continuing this effort in conjunction with the Town of Evan’s motto “we are open for business”! Let’s support our local businesses, and make Angola vibrant and bustling once again.
